Essex County Executive Joseph N. DiVincenzo, Jr. said today that the deer hunt at the South Mountain, Eagle Rock and Hilltop reservations reduced the herds in those parklands by 250 adult and unborn deer and provided 32,000 meals to needy families through the Community FoodBank of New Jersey. Essex County will seek to cull up to 175 deer from its parklands during its third annual deer hunt, which begins on Tuesday, January 19. Essex County is taking bids from vendors to develop a family-friendly, lake-view restaurant at South Mountain Reservation. The site at the corner of Northfield Avenue and Pleasant Valley Way in West Orange will also have a miniature golf course and surface parking lot.
